Python考试———部分填空题

  1. 1.在读写的过程中,__tell__方法可以获取当前的读写位置。
  2. 2.如果要搜索模块中的路径,我们通常用到 system 模块中的__path__变量。
  3. 3.Os.path 模块中可以使用__join__进行模块的拼接。
  4. 4.按照文件中数据的组织形式,可以分为__文本文件__,__二进制文件__。
  5. 5.读取文件的三种方式__read__,__readline__,__readlines__。
  6. 6.Seek 方法用于移动指针到指定位置,那么它的_offset___参数表示偏移的字节数
  7. 7.Os 模块中的 makedir 用于创建一个__目录__。
  8. 8.Python 中所有异常的父类是__BaseException__   。
  9. 9.想 要 在 python 程 序 中主动的抛出异常,我们可 以 使 用 __raise__,__assert__语 句
  10. 10.当使用序列中不存在的____时,会引发 IndexError 的异常   索引
  11. 11.一个 try 语句只能对应_ finally___语句。
  12. 12.在没有__except。__的 try 语句中去使用 else 会引起语法误。
  13. 13.Python 中的__re__模块可以使用正则表达式
  14. 14.正则表达式中的__sub__和__subn__方法是用来替换目标文件中的匹配项
  15. 15.正则表达式有两种匹配,分别是__贪婪匹配__,__非贪婪匹配__。
  16. 16.列表可以使用内置的__list__函数创建。 
  17. 17.Python 中列表的元素可以通过索引(或切片)过程的方式访问。
  18.  
### 数据结构期末考试中的程序填空题 对于准备数据结构课程的期末考试而言,针对程序填空题部分可以采取多种方式进行复习和练习。一种有效的方法是从教科书以及在线资源获取相关的题目集来加强理解[^1]。 #### 获取官方教材配套资源 许多大学使用的经典数据结构教材通常会配备有教师手册或是学生辅助材料,在这些资料里往往能找到精心设计好的程序填空题用于巩固知识点的学习效果。例如,《数据结构与算法分析》这类书籍可能会提供一系列由浅入深的问题帮助考生熟悉不同难度级别的编程技巧[^2]。 #### 利用网络平台进行专项训练 除了传统纸质版学习工具外,互联网上也存在大量优质的免费资源可供利用。像LeetCode、Codeforces等知名网站都设有专门的数据结构板块,其中不乏适合用来模拟真实考场景况下的试题形式——即给出一段不完整的代码片段让使用者补充完成特定功能的部分[^3]。 ```python def reverse_list(head): prev = None current = head while _______: # 需要填写条件判断语句使得循环能够遍历整个链表并反转节点指向关系 next_node = current.next current.next = _____ # 此处应设置前驱结点作为当前结点的新next指针目标 prev = ___________ # 更新prev为现current以便下一轮迭代使用 current = next_node return prev # 返回新的头结点 ``` 通过上述方式可以获得足够的实践机会从而更好地应对即将到来的数据结构期末测试当中的程序填空类问题[^4]。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值